Shri Naliya Parshvanath Atishay Kshetra Yatra Gujarat

Shri Naliya Parshvanath Atishay Kshetra, located in the serene region of Kutch, Gujarat, is one of the most revered Jain tirths devoted to Lord Parshvanath, the 23rd Tirthankara. With centuries-old significance, this place is believed to be an Atishay Kshetra, where divine miracles and spiritual experiences have been witnessed by countless devotees.

The magnificent marble temple is known for its peaceful ambiance, artistic carvings, and deity idol that radiates divinity. Pilgrims believe that sincere prayers offered here remove obstacles and lead to spiritual prosperity. Several miraculous incidents are said to have occurred at this kshetra, strengthening the faith of followers.

Situated away from the city rush, the kshetra offers an ideal environment for meditation, religious rituals, and inner peace. The temple premises are well-maintained and provide a spiritually uplifting atmosphere. Pilgrims can also explore nearby holy sites, making it an important part of Jain pilgrimage circuits in Kutch.

FAQ About Shri Naliya Parshvanath Atishay Kshetra Gujarat

Q. What is the best time to visit Shri Naliya Parshvanath Atishay Kshetra?
The best time to visit is between October and March when the weather is pleasant and comfortable for travel. It is advisable to avoid peak summer due to high temperatures in the Kutch region.
Q. How much time is required for darshan and rituals at the temple?
Typically, 1 to 2 hours are sufficient to complete darshan, pooja, parikrama, and meditation. Devotees seeking longer spiritual sessions may spend additional time as per their preference.
Q. Is accommodation available near the Naliya temple?
Limited accommodation options are available near the temple, mainly dharamshalas. Most pilgrims prefer staying in Bhuj, where better hotels and Jain-friendly eateries are available.
Q. What type of meals are provided during the tour?
Only pure vegetarian meals are included. Jain food without onion and garlic can be arranged on request. Packed meals may be provided during temple visits.
Q. Is this tour suitable for senior citizens?
Yes, the tour is suitable for elderly pilgrims as it involves minimal walking. However, transportation assistance and support are recommended. Wheelchair arrangements can be made upon prior request.
Q. Are mobile phones and cameras allowed inside the temple premises?
Photography and mobile usage may be restricted inside the temple. Devotees should follow guidelines issued by temple authorities during darshan.
Q. Can this trip be extended to cover other Jain pilgrimage sites?
Yes, the tour can be extended to include Bhadreshwar Jain Tirth, Shankheshwar Parshwanath, or Girnar Ji. Custom itineraries can be designed based on the number of travel days.
Q. What is the nearest airport or railway station to Naliya Parshvanath?
The nearest major transportation hub is Bhuj Airport and Bhuj Railway Station, located approximately 125 to 130 km from the temple.
Q. Are special rituals or poojas arranged by the temple?
Yes, special abhishek and pooja can be arranged upon request. Devotees should inform in advance to coordinate directly with the temple authorities.
